Remove build warnings related to ZMQ #360

Closed
opened 2022-05-04 17:35:19 +00:00 by serkixenos · 1 comment
serkixenos commented 2022-05-04 17:35:19 +00:00 (Migrated from gitlab.com)
/pe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p: In member function ‘void graphene::peerplays_sidechain::zmq_listener::handle_zmq()’:
/pe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1082:51: warning: ‘void zmq::detail::socket_base::setsockopt(int, const void*, size_t)’ is deprecated: from 4.7.0, use `set` taking option from zmq::sockopt [-Wdeprecated-declarations]
 1082 |    socket.setsockopt(ZMQ_SUBSCRIBE, "hashblock", 9);
      |                                                   ^
In file included from /usr/local/include/zmq_addon.hpp:27,
                 from /peerplays/libraries/plugins/peerplays_sidechain/include/graphene/peerplays_sidechain/sidechain_net_handler_bitcoin.hpp:6,
                 from /pe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1:
/usr/local/include/zmq.hpp:1676:10: note: declared here
 1676 |     void setsockopt(int option_, const void *optval_, size_t optvallen_)
      |          ^~~~~~~~~~
/pe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1083:57: warning: ‘void zmq::detail::socket_base::setsockopt(int, const void*, size_t)’ is deprecated: from 4.7.0, use `set` taking option from zmq::sockopt [-Wdeprecated-declarations]
 1083 |    socket.setsockopt(ZMQ_LINGER, &linger, sizeof(linger));
      |                                                         ^
In file included from /usr/local/include/zmq_addon.hpp:27,
                 from /peerplays/libraries/plugins/peerplays_sidechain/include/graphene/peerplays_sidechain/sidechain_net_handler_bitcoin.hpp:6,
                 from /pe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1:
/usr/local/include/zmq.hpp:1676:10: note: declared here
 1676 |     void setsockopt(int option_, const void *optval_, size_t optvallen_)
      |          ^~~~~~~~~~
``` /pe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p: In member function ‘void graphene::peerplays_sidechain::zmq_listener::handle_zmq()’: /pe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1082:51: warning: ‘void zmq::detail::socket_base::setsockopt(int, const void*, size_t)’ is deprecated: from 4.7.0, use `set` taking option from zmq::sockopt [-Wdeprecated-declarations] 1082 | socket.setsockopt(ZMQ_SUBSCRIBE, "hashblock", 9); | ^ In file included from /usr/local/include/zmq_addon.hpp:27, from /peerplays/libraries/plugins/peerplays_sidechain/include/graphene/peerplays_sidechain/sidechain_net_handler_bitcoin.hpp:6, from /pe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1: /usr/local/include/zmq.hpp:1676:10: note: declared here 1676 | void setsockopt(int option_, const void *optval_, size_t optvallen_) | ^~~~~~~~~~ /pe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1083:57: warning: ‘void zmq::detail::socket_base::setsockopt(int, const void*, size_t)’ is deprecated: from 4.7.0, use `set` taking option from zmq::sockopt [-Wdeprecated-declarations] 1083 | socket.setsockopt(ZMQ_LINGER, &linger, sizeof(linger)); | ^ In file included from /usr/local/include/zmq_addon.hpp:27, from /peerplays/libraries/plugins/peerplays_sidechain/include/graphene/peerplays_sidechain/sidechain_net_handler_bitcoin.hpp:6, from /peerplays/libraries/plugins/peerplays_sidechain/sidechain_net_handler_bitcoin.cpp:1: /usr/local/include/zmq.hpp:1676:10: note: declared here 1676 | void setsockopt(int option_, const void *optval_, size_t optvallen_) | ^~~~~~~~~~ ```
serkixenos commented 2022-05-04 17:35:19 +00:00 (Migrated from gitlab.com)

assigned to @pavel.baykov

assigned to @pavel.baykov
serkixenos (Migrated from gitlab.com) closed this issue 2022-05-06 12:55:30 +00:00
Sign in to join this conversation.
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ference: Peerplays_Blockchain/peerplays_migrated#360
No description provided.